Beyond the Operating Room: Emerging Segments in the South Korea Medical Robotics Market
Description: This post highlights the market's growing diversity, moving beyond surgical applications to encompass rehabilitation, pharmacy, and logistics automation.
While Surgical Robots remain the largest and most transformative segment, driving growth through minimally invasive procedures, the South Korea Medical Robotics Market is rapidly diversifying its product portfolio. This expansion is moving robotics out of the operating theater and into other vital areas of healthcare delivery, signaling a maturation of the industry. The segmentation now includes Noninvasive Radiosurgery Robots for precise cancer treatments and an array of systems enhancing operational efficiencies across hospitals and clinics.
One of the most promising emerging segments is Rehabilitation Robots. These systems are gaining crucial traction as they provide much-needed assistance to patients recovering from surgeries, injuries, or neurological conditions, effectively enhancing physical therapy outcomes. With a strong focus on enhancing patient recovery and optimizing hospital throughput, rehabilitation robotics are increasingly deployed across various clinical settings, including in-patient facilities, out-patient specialty centers, and even in home-care environments.
Furthermore, Hospital and Pharmacy Robots are becoming essential for streamlining non-clinical, routine tasks. These systems, often classified as Logistics/Handling Robotic Systems, automate material handling, medication dispensing, and inventory management. By taking over repetitive and time-consuming duties, these automation solutions free up nurses, pharmacists, and technical staff, allowing them to focus more intensely on direct patient care, thereby enhancing the overall quality and efficiency of the South Korea Medical Robotics Market.
